7 January 2009 Preparation and characterization of TiO2 - polymer composite films

Abstract
Interaction between polymers and nanoparticles are known to influence structure and properties of polymer materials containing dispersed nanomaterials. Titanium oxide was prepared by sol-gel method and used as inorganic materials; polyvinyl alcohol was used as polymer matrix. The objectives of this paper are to synthesize and characterized TiO2 - polymer composite. TiO2 nanoparticles were dispersed in polymer solution with the aid of ultrasonic vibration to obtained polymer composite materials. The properties of TiO2 - polymer composite films were characterized by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y (FT-IR), scanning electron microscopy (SEM) and optical microscopy. FT-IR showed that there existed a strong interaction at the interface of TiO2 and polymer, which implied that the polymer chains were grafted onto the surface of TiO2 nanoparticles. It can be also be seen from SEM images that the TiO2 nanoparticles were perfect dispersed in polymer matrix.
